Kurt Busiek has stated he won't be bringin old AQ back but I have no doubt he'll be back sometime. He's just going through a phase that nearly every other hero at DC and Marvel has...the replacement phase. It's a staple of comics and now our beloved is joining the ranks of the elite by having it done (about damn time if you ask me) not to mention KB is giving AQ a much needed quickening by taking Atlantis, the telepathy, the hand, the costume and all the other distractions out of the picture and focusing on AQ lore and his place in the DCU. My only hope is that this replacement is more like a Azrael then a Kyle Rayner and it doesn't take 10 damn years to get AQ back.
